    Please help! I am confused after reading an answer about confirming dinner ressies. I booked online and got a printout of conf. #'s. Should I be calling someone to reconfirm and if so, who? We leave in 6 weeks. Thank you for you help.

    Hi, Jaynee!   If you made your Advance Dining Reservations and have your confirmation numbers, you are all set!   I suggest making a master list of all your reservations, including date, time, location, and confirmation number for each reservation.   Make 2 copies - one for you and one for another responsible adult in your party.  Just in case you lose one copy, you have a back-up.  (Yes, as you can guess, I learned to do this from a bad experience of  a "has-anyone-seen-my-list-of-reservations" panic!)

    Great job getting your reservations made!  You will be happy to have a table waiting for you when you arrive at your restaurant!   Have fun!
